父窗口里打开一个子窗口后,当父窗口又转到其他画面时,如何关闭子窗口? 请指教! 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 用window.open打开的子页面可以在onunload里关闭比如var win = window.open(url)window.onunload=function(){win.close()} a页面代码<a href="b.htm" target="_blank">b页面</a><a href="c.htm">c页面</a>b页面代码<script language="javascript"> var fa=opener.location.href;function a(){if (opener.location.href!=fa) self.close();}setInterval("a()",1000);</script> <body onunload="closeAllWin();">var winlist = new Array(); function closeAllWin(){ for(var i= 0; i < winlist.length; i++) if(!winlist[i].closed) winlist[i].close(); } 仿爱卡 大图轮播 效果 JSP 批量插入数据库问题,新手求助 JS能实现A页面动态生成新页面B然后弹出吗? !!急 关于一个输入限制的问题 关于js中字符串相等的判断问题??? 【求解】js 获取农历当月天数 请问表单元素如何删除 救急!!!javascript问题 MD5withRSA签名 插入视频网站影片,如何做到播完自己转下一片 奇怪问题: 如何验证字符串中包含URL
比如
var win = window.open(url)
window.onunload=function(){
win.close()
}
<a href="b.htm" target="_blank">b页面</a>
<a href="c.htm">c页面</a>b页面代码
<script language="javascript">
var fa=opener.location.href;
function a(){
if (opener.location.href!=fa)
self.close();
}
setInterval("a()",1000);
</script>
function closeAllWin(){
for(var i= 0; i < winlist.length; i++)
if(!winlist[i].closed)
winlist[i].close();
}